She
was born to Clifton and
Addie (Wright) Stanley
on April 20, 1926, in
Cheap, Kentucky, and
died Friday January 5,
2007 in Enid, Oklahoma.
Charlie grew up in
Fayetteville, West
Virginia. She met Frank
Andrew Rust at Fort
Bragg, North Carolina,
and they were married on
October 3, 1947 in
Chesterfield, South
Carolina. They lived in
Baltimore, Oklahoma, and
California before
returning back to
Oklahoma where they
lived the remainder of
her life. She worked as
a carpenter’s helper,
and at Grace’s Café,
Salt Plains Lake for
many years. Charlie
enjoyed shooting guns,
doing crafts, and making
mop dolls, but her
greatest pleasure was
being with her
grandkids.
